We can not say exactly which year each of the New Testament gospels was written, but we can come close.
Scholars say that Mark's Gospel was written approxmately 70 CE.
Matthew's Gospel is believed to have been written during the 80s CE, although Raymond E Brown (''An Introduction to the New Testament'') cautions to allow a few years either side of that decade.
Luke's gospel was written in the 90s of the first century, or early in the second century.
John's Gospel was written early in the second century.

According to scholar Michael Powell, a strong argument for the early dating of all four Gospels before 70 AD is the absence of references to the destruction of the Jerusalem Temple, which occurred in that year. The Gospels contain significant events and teachings of Jesus that would likely have been interpreted in light of the Temple's destruction if they had been written afterwards. Additionally, Powell points to the rapid spread of Christianity and the need for authoritative texts to guide early believers as further evidence supporting an earlier composition date. This context suggests that the Gospels were written while eyewitnesses were still alive and the events were fresh in memory.

It is believed that none of the gospels was written in Palestine. By the time the first gospel was written, around the year 70 CE, it seems that Christianity had already spread outside the vicinity where Jesus walked.

The term 'evangelist' is generally used to apply to the authors of the four New Testament gospels. All four gospels were originally anonymous, but were attributed by the Church Fathers, later in the second century, to the disciples thought most likely to have written them. Since we do not know who 'Mark' really was, other than that he was not the Mark mentioned by Paul, we can not say with certainty when he was born. What perhaps we can say is that if he was between perhaps 30 and 50 years old in the year 70, when he wrote the Gospel, he would have been born between about 20 CE and 40 CE.
